From aaee2ffaed818ccaf248b4097a3b7c7bfa4ea82a Mon Sep 17 00:00:00 2001 From: Corinna Vinschen Date: Fri, 23 Feb 2007 10:51:59 +0000 Subject: * exceptions.cc (dummy_ctrl_c_handler): Remove. (init_console_handler): Drop has_null_console_handler_routine checks. * fhandler_raw.cc (fhandler_dev_raw::open): Drop has_raw_devices check. * fhandler_serial.cc (fhandler_serial::open): Drop .supports_reading_modem_output_lines check. * miscfuncs.cc (low_priority_sleep): Drop has_switch_to_thread check. * shared.cc (open_shared): Drop needs_memory_protection checks. * spawn.cc (spawn_guts): Drop start_proc_suspended check. * uname.cc (uname): Drop has_valid_processorlevel check. * wincap.cc: Remove has_raw_devices, has_valid_processorlevel, supports_reading_modem_output_lines, needs_memory_protection, has_switch_to_thread, start_proc_suspended and has_null_console_handler_routine throughout. * wincap.h: Ditto. --- winsup/cygwin/shared.cc |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'winsup/cygwin/shared.cc') diff --git a/winsup/cygwin/shared.cc b/winsup/cygwin/shared.cc index 705cc16f9..a60d361fb 100644 --- a/winsup/cygwin/shared.cc +++ b/winsup/cygwin/shared.cc @@ -69,8 +69,7 @@ open_shared (const char *name, int n, HANDLE& shared_h, DWORD size, void *shared; void *addr; - if ((m == SH_JUSTCREATE || m == SH_JUSTOPEN) - || !wincap.needs_memory_protection () && offsets[0]) + if (m == SH_JUSTCREATE || m == SH_JUSTOPEN) addr = NULL; else { @@ -122,7 +121,7 @@ open_shared (const char *name, int n, HANDLE& shared_h, DWORD size, if (!shared) api_fatal ("MapViewOfFileEx '%s'(%p), %E. Terminating.", mapname, shared_h); - if (m == SH_USER_SHARED && offsets[0] && wincap.needs_memory_protection ()) + if (m == SH_USER_SHARED && offsets[0]) { ptrdiff_t delta = (caddr_t) shared - (caddr_t) off_addr (0); offsets[0] = (caddr_t) shared - (caddr_t) cygwin_hmodule; -- cgit v1.2.3